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
701757 5928228 441
488595681 62
488595681 62
84651 61 8600 18
All about undefined
Interested in learning more?
488595681 62
84651 61 8600 18
See more
47 4473
6438304557 684 3795081359 47
See more
0156645 917 6126579
28 591671091 9218733 2516
See more